Questionable Glow on Infinity Sword
Something I have noticed on The Infinity Sword is on the sheath. There seems to be a smooth lava-like glow on the upper end of the sheath (by the hilt). I'm not sure if it's purposeful if you could inform me as to what it is or if it's simply an error where the rest of it is not covered/loaded up the whole sheath (the molten pattern that doesn't glow).

At any rate, the glow on the scabbard's locket (which is that top piece you're inquiring about) is intentional, though probably not ideal. It's essentially the metal of the locket heating up in time with the glow on the scabbard's body (with all the scales) but since the locket is rather dark, the texture doesn't show through the glow very well in some cases.
